class Race implements Callable<Integer>{
private int step=0;
private String name;
private long time;
private boolean flag=true;
Race(String name,long time){
this.name=name;
this.time=time;
}
@Override
public Integer call() throws Exception {
while(flag){
Thread.sleep(time);
step++;
}
return step;
}
public void setFlag(boolean flag){
this.flag=flag;
}
}
Callable实现多线程
最新推荐文章于 2023-11-10 17:09:11 发布